Nuendo 3.x represented Steinberg’s push to position Nuendo as a premier post-production DAW, bridging music production features with film/game audio needs. Many architectural decisions from this era influenced later versions’ focus on video, surround, and media exchange standards.

: Building on Nuendo 3's core features, this era marked the first major support for the AAF (Advanced Authoring Format) file format, essential for exchanging project data with video editors like Avid Media Composer. Hardware Integration and Customization Steinberg Nuendo 3.2.0
